Output 95f66135adf9b51a39d19fc0561a5c967289a5d09e8650a7dac3ec4fcb0c6fb5:1

value
1448909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f6108668d61fb64de525f3c1b903fe04c804ad1 OP_EQUALVERIFY OP_CHECKSIG
address
13rvBuV85QwaWiDoNaEgpuhRKScB8jujWz
transaction
95f66135adf9b51a39d19fc0561a5c967289a5d09e8650a7dac3ec4fcb0c6fb5
confirmations
97144
spent
true